Seasonal Road Closure Notice: HWY 120 (Tioga Pass) generally closes for the winter from late October through late June. Daily closures can also occur during periods of inclement weather in spring and fall. The Eastern entrance to Yosemite National Park is located 45 minutes from Mammoth Lakes. Yosemite's Eastern Gate or Tuolumne Meadows is not accessible when Tioga Pass is closed. All other Yosemite National Park entrances are open year round. Guests are advised to check local road conditions/closures before travel with the California Department of Transportation at www.dot.ca.gov or by calling 800-427-7623.

The Mammoth Mountain Inn offers ski-in, ski-out accommodations for the Main Lodge area at Mammoth Mountain ski area. In the Spring season, there is no closer access to the lifts or parking than the Mammoth Mountain Inn. The cozy lobby fireplace and authentic mountain lodge charm can't be beat, but one has to be forgiving that the property was built years ago. My room was clean, the amenities adequate, and the service polite and efficient. But no amount of Joanna Gaines is going to bring a 1950's construction up to Kardashian levels of square footage or glam. Overall, my stay was great, and I got everything I was expecting and a good Spring season value!
